Transaction 287811f4baea6baf61d54fedf29e773e5f23d4efee494134f9f74ffef884913f

1 Input
2 Outputs
  • 287811f4baea6baf61d54fedf29e773e5f23d4efee494134f9f74ffef884913f:0
  • value  59258988
    address  3MAkgWEdW7aCeW31sKs5EEsSwpx2m39Nd8
  • 287811f4baea6baf61d54fedf29e773e5f23d4efee494134f9f74ffef884913f:1
  • value  92130660
    address  17Fyzua86C3mNC7hg8feyYmU56GZkR5Lvc